    Community orientation in the pre-disaster phase is vital for fostering a prepared and resilient populace. By educating community members about potential disaster risks, their local vulnerabilities, and the expected impacts, individuals are empowered to take proactive measures. This foundational knowledge encourages self-reliance and enhances their ability to respond effectively when a disaster strikes, reducing panic and improving overall safety outcomes.
